About College
With the incessant expansion of Pharmacy profession, the demand for competent and proficient pharmacists is on climb. It was with this aim of imparting excellent & comprehensive education to blossoming pharmacists, Marathwada Mitramandal’s College of Pharmacy (MMCOP) was established in 2006. MMCOP is an institution run by Marathwada Mitramandal, Pune, a Public Charitable Trust established way back in 1967, by Hon’ble Late Shri. Shankarraoji Chavan, Ex. Home Minister, Govt. of India. Trust has a meritorious record of running different professional institutions at its various educational complexes; offering excellent education to about 16,000 students. MMCOP has well expert and knowledgeable teaching staff steered by the Principal Dr. Manohar J. Patil, a renowned personality in the field. The Institution has excellent educational environment along with best infra-structural facilities. Unique feature of MMCOP is its emphasis on one-to-one Student-Teacher Interaction, helping the students to build their confidence and enhance their subject understanding. MMCOP is approved by All India Council for Technical Education, Pharmacy Council of India, New Delhi, Recognized by Govt. of Maharashtra, Directorate of Technical Education, Mumbai (MS), Permanently Affiliated to Savitribai Phule Pune University, Pune. Uka Tarsadia University (UTU), established in 2011, by Gujarat State Private University amendment act 25 of 2011, is located on the Bardoli- Saputara state highway at Bardoli, Di: Surat, Gujarat, India. The university has taken rapid strides and is emerging as one of the leading universities in the field of higher education in Gujarat. UTU leads a culture that supports teaching learning excellence and has 15 constituent institutes, 4 departments under 7 faculties offering 76 career oriented academic programmes at diploma, undergraduate, postgraduate & doctoral level. The university offers a comprehensive array of academic programs across the disciplines of Management, Commerce, Engineering & Technology, Architecture, Design, Applied Science (Chemistry, Physics, Mathematics, Biotechnology, Micro-biology), Computer Science, Pharmacy, Nursing and Physiotherapy. University is committed to provide need based, industry focused education nurturing in an inclusive environment.

Christ University blossomed  out of the educational vision of Carmelites of Mary Immaculate (CMI).  Saint  Kuriakose Eliias Chavara , the founder of this indigenous congregation was  a well known educationist and  social reformer of the 19th century. Christ University is today a leading educational destination for students from India and other countries. The University offers Undergraduate, Post graduate  and Doctoral Programs in Humanities, Social Sciences, Sciences, Commerce,  Management, Law and Education. 
The  Ontario Institute for Studies in Education, OISE, is an international leader in  initial and continuing teacher education, graduate studies in education, and education research. Established in 1906, OISE is the University of Toronto's  Faculty of Education. Areas of teaching, learning and research include: adult education and counselling psychology; curriculum, teaching and learning;  educational administration, higher education; history and philosophy of education; human development and applied psychology; sociology and equity studies in education; and, education policy and practice.
The Society for the Integration of Traditional Healing into Counselling  Psychology, Psychotherapy and Psychiatry (SITHCP3) is developed to promote, encourage and nurture research on the integration of traditional healing practices into counselling psychology, psychotherapy, and psychiatry. The international society will serve as a reference group to researchers, health practitioners, traditional healers, and community workers interested in the interface between talking therapies and spiritual approaches to healing in counselling psychology, psychotherapy, and psychiatry.

The journey of Centurion University of Technology and Management (CUTM) began in the year 2005 by a group of ambitious academics with aspirations to provide high quality education both nationally and internationally. The first step in this direction was to take over an ailing engineering Institute, the Jagannath Institute for Technology and Management (JITM) in one of the most challenging tribal districts of Odisha and one which was considered to be a left-wing extremist affected area. Subsequently, JITM was transformed into Centurion University of Technology and Management in August 2010, through an act of Odisha Legislative Assembly. It became the First Multi-Sector State Private University in Odisha

ISCB conference has prime objective to provide an opportunity for a close interaction of scientists with varied interests in diverse fields of the research. Conference will also provide common platform and more opportunities to the researchers in the areas of chemical sciences and biological sciences and other related areas to interact with each other. ISCBC will also provide a forum for in-depth assessment of the challenges involved in the dynamic and fast moving field of Drug research. It will bring together leading Chemists, medicinal chemists, pharmacologists, biotechnologists, and other allied professionals to discuss and present the latest important developments in drug discovery and therapeutics. It is expected that approximately thousand delegates will participate coming from different part of India and abroad. A large number of pharmaceutical and biotechnology industry professionals will join us for this event, share ideas and built networks. 

Several distinguished speakers presented their work in ISCB conferences including Prof. Robert H Grubbs, Nobel Laureate (California Institute of Technology, Pasadena, USA) delivered a keynote lecture on the olefin metathesis reaction. 

Prof. Nancy B Jackson (President ACS, ISCBC-2010), Prof. David St C Black (Secretary General IUPAC, ISCBC-2010) Australia, Dr. Nicole Moreau (ISCBC-2011) President of the International Union of Pure and Applied Chemistry (IUPAC) France and several eminent scientists from United States, United Kingdom, Greece, Canada, France, Switzerland, Germany, Netherlands, Austria, Belgium, Sweden, Japan, Taiwan, Korea, Iran, Egypt participated ISCB conferences. 

Her Excellency Shrimati Kamla, the Governor of Gujarat (ISCBC-2011), Honorable union minister of Home Shri Sushil Kumar Shinde (ISCBC-2012),His Excellency the Hon'ble Governor of Assam, Sri Janaki Ballav Patnaik, Sri Tarun Gogoi, Chief Minister of Assam (ISCBC-2012) and Prof. Raghunath A. Mashelkar FRS former DG, CSIR, President Global Research (ISCBC-2004, 2011) Alliance, Pune, Dr. T. Ramasami, Secretary (ISCBC-2012) Dept. of Science & Technology, Govt. of India, Professor Goverdhan Mehta, FRS (National Research Professor, Hyderabad, ISCBC-2008, 2014) these are few names of dignitaries who participated our ISCBC and grace the occasion. 

Last year 24th ISCB International Conference  was organized at Manipal University, Jaipur, India. Approximately 600 delegates participated in the conference from US, Germany, Belgium, Sweden, France, UK, Japan etc.
